About Converting Micrograys to Grays
Microgray and Gray both belong to the radiation-measurement family, though radiation quantities fall into genuinely distinct categories: absorbed dose (gray, rad) measures energy deposited in matter, equivalent dose (sievert, rem) weights that for biological harm, and activity (becquerel, curie) measures how often a radioactive source decays — this page only converts between units of the same kind. Specifically: Microgray is 0.000001 gray units, and gray is absorbed dose in joules per kilogram.
Formula
grays = micrograys × 0.000001
This factor comes from each unit's defined relationship to the category's base unit: 1 microgray equals 0.000001 base units, and 1 gray equals 1 base unit, so dividing one by the other gives the direct microgray-to-gray factor of 0.000001.

Understanding the Gray
Gray (Gy) measures absorbed radiation dose. The SI derived unit of absorbed radiation dose, equal to one joule of radiation energy absorbed per kilogram of matter. It is classified as a SI derived unit.
Where it's used: Universal — SI derived unit used worldwide in medicine and radiation protection
Gray vs. sievert. The gray measures physically absorbed energy; the sievert measures equivalent dose, which weights the gray value for how biologically damaging a given type of radiation is. The same absorbed dose in gray can correspond to different sievert values depending on the radiation type.

History of the Gray
The gray is named after Louis Harold Gray (1905–1965), a British physicist who pioneered the physics of radiation dosimetry and its biological effects, and was adopted by the CGPM as an SI derived unit in 1975.
